Morgan Rhodes

    Morgan Rhodes channels her childhood fantasy of being a sword-wielding princess into writing, a pursuit she finds equally rewarding and far less perilous. Her work is characterized by imaginative realms where adventure and suspense intertwine, exploring themes of heroism and magic. While a national bestselling author of paranormal novels under another name, this high fantasy debut showcases her command of intricate world-building. Rhodes's narratives reflect a keen eye for detail, likely influenced by her passion for photography and her discerning taste as a voracious reader.

    • Rebel spring

      • 432 pages
      • 16 hours of reading

      War brought them together. Love will tear them apart. This fantastic second installment of the Falling Kingdoms series picks up in the middle of thrilling drama that made the first Falling Kingdoms novel a New York Times bestseller. The kingdom of Auranos--and Princess Cleo along with it--has been conquered and the three kingdoms of Auranos, Limeros, and Paelsiaare now unwillingly united as one country called Mytica. But alluring, dangerous magic still beckons, and with it the chance to rule not just Mytica, but the world. When King Gaius announces that a road is to be built into the Forbidden Mountains, formally linking all of Mytica together, he sets off a chain of cataclysmic events that will forever change the face of this land.

    • Falling Kingdoms

      • 412 pages
      • 15 hours of reading

      In the three kingdoms of Mytica, magic has long been forgotten. And while hard-won peace has reigned for centuries, a deadly unrest now simmers below the surface. As the rulers of each kingdom grapple for power, the lives of their subjects are brutally transformed... and four key players, royals and rebels alike, find their fates forever intertwined. Cleo, Jonas, Lucia, and Magnus are caught in a dizzying world of treacherous betrayals, shocking murders, secret alliances, and even unforeseen love. The only outcome that's certain is that kingdoms will fall. Who will emerge triumphant when all they know has collapsed? It's the eve of war.... Choose your side. Princess: Raised in pampered luxury, Cleo must now embark on a rough and treacherous journey into enemy territory in search of magic long thought extinct. Rebel: Jonas, enraged at injustice, lashes out against the forces of oppression that have kept his country cruelly impoverished. To his shock, he finds himself the leader of a people's revolution centuries in the making. Sorceress: Lucia, adopted at birth into the royal family, discovers the truth about her past—and the supernatural legacy she is destined to wield. Heir: Bred for aggression and trained to conquer, firstborn son Magnus begins to realize that the heart can be more lethal than the sword....
